    Finaly sorted.I added the "Enhancer for YouTube"extension to Firefox and ticked the two boxes "Force the use of standard frame
    rates formats istead of high rate frame formats"and "Force the use of the MP4 format and the AVC codec instead of the Web M
    format and the VP9 codec".I don`t know what any of this means but it solved the problem,hope this helps someone else.
